Linux里Ubuntu图系统文件或文件夹复制和移动文件夹,统计当前文件夹下文件或图片的数量,解压rar压缩包

1.复制文件夹到随意指定文件夹路径

cp 空格-r空格/路径/空格/路径/(可能有点慢),最后把train文件夹复制到了zj1文件夹下

cp -r /home/sdb/hx/WKL/data_set/flower_data/train/ /home/sdb/hx/WKL/zjdata/zj1/

2.移动文件夹到指定目录、文件、压缩包

(base) hx@hzsfxy-SYS-4028GR-TR2:~/WKL/zjdata/训练集$ mv "/home/sdb/hx/WKL/zjdata/训练集/female/" "/home/sdb/hx/WKL/zjdata/训练集/data/"
(base) hx@hzsfxy-SYS-4028GR-TR2:~/WKL/zjdata/训练集$ mv "/home/sdb/hx/WKL/zjdata/训练集/male/" "/home/sdb/hx/WKL/zjdata/训练集/data/"

3.linux里统计当前文件夹下图片的数量

(base) ▒hx@hzsfxy-SYS-4028GR-TR2:~/WKL/zjdata/训练集/母腹部圆$ ls -lhr|grep '.jpg'|wc -l

733
#文件夹及文件
(base) ▒hx@hzsfxy-SYS-4028GR-TR2:~/WKL/zjdata/训练集/母腹部圆$ ls | wc -w
737

4.解压rar压缩包

1、rar命令

rar a test.rar file1 file2  #压缩

2、unrar命令

unrar e test.rar DestPath  #解压(会在把当前压缩包内容解压到当前目录内,容易造成解压内容和当前目录原文件混合,不容易区分,不建议使用)

unrar x test.rar DestPath  #解压(会在当前解压目录内产生一个以压缩包名字命名的目录,目录内是解压内容,推荐使用)

猜你喜欢

转载自blog.csdn.net/qq_55433305/article/details/129327250
今日推荐